如何解决 golang 中的 “cannot use x (type y) as type z in map index” 错误

在使用 Golang 进行开发过程中,经常会遇到 “cannot use x (type y) as type z in map index” 的错误提示。这个错误提示一般是因为我们在使用 map 类型时没有注意键值的类型问题,但是具体的情况因人而异,错误原因可能会比较复杂。在本篇文章中,我们将会介绍如何排查这个错误,并解决它。首先,我们需要明确 Golang 中的 map 类型是一个键值对结构。K...

未定义的偏移量1-Undefined offset: 1错误该怎样解决

未定义的偏移量1php 错误事件:E_NOTICE Run-time 通知。脚本发现可能有错误发生,但也可能在脚本正常运行时发生。C:\WWW\weixin\member\shop\skin\23.php错误行数:第8行错误原因:Undefined offset: 1源代码:$DHeight = array('320','63','121','121','121','93','63','187','...

如何修复Windows Live照片库加载photoviewer.dll错误

装程序仍可在其他地方下载,即使该产品无法再通过官方渠道在 Windows 11 上安装或使用。下载广受喜爱的 Microsoft 应用程序后,用户在加载 wix photoviewer.dll 时遇到错误,并且似乎被卡住了。在我们看到 .NET Framework 的作用之后,我们将继续为您列出的解决方案。.NET 框架有什么作用?Windows 程序在 .Net Framework 上生成和运行,该...

linux - 安装php错误I was not able to diagnose which libmcrypt version you

回复内容: 少依赖装一下libmcrypt 你没装libmcrypt呀。rpm -qa libmcrypt 看一下版本呢 ...

PHP 7新特性探索:如何使用新的错误处理机制(Error和ErrorException类)

PHP 7新特性探索:如何使用新的错误处理机制(Error和ErrorException类)引言:随着PHP 7的发布,我们迎来了一批令人兴奋的新特性,其中之一是改进的错误处理机制。在过去的版本中,我们经常使用传统的错误报告机制(警告、致命错误等)来捕获脚本中的错误。然而,PHP 7引入了两个新的类,Error和ErrorException,为我们带来了更好的错误处理体验。本文将介绍这两个类的使用方...

php错误控制运算符@ or die()实例用法详解

PHP 支持一个错误控制运算符:@。当将其放置在一个 PHP 表达式之前,该表达式可能产生的任何错误信息都被忽略掉。如果用 set_error_handler() 设定了自定义的错误处理函数,仍然会被调用,但是此错误处理函数可以(并且也应该)调用 error_reporting() ,而该函数在出错语句前有 @ 时将返回 0。如果激活了 track_errors 特性,表达式所产生的任何错误信息都被...

python错误:AttributeError: 'module' object has no attribute 'setdefaultencoding'问题的解决方法

Python的字符集处理实在蛋疼,目前使用UTF-8居多,然后默认使用的字符集是ascii,所以我们需要改成utf-8查看目前系统字符集复制代码 代码如下:import sysprint sys.getdefaultencoding() 执行:复制代码 代码如下:[root@lee ~]# python a.py ascii 修改成utf-8复制代码 代码如下:import sys ...

python错误:AttributeError: 'module' object has no attribute 's

Python的字符集处理实在蛋疼,目前使用UTF-8居多,然后默认使用的字符集是ascii,所以我们需要改成utf-8查看目前系统字符集 代码如下:import sysprint sys.getdefaultencoding() 执行: 代码如下:[root@lee ~]# python a.py ascii 修改成utf-8 代码如下:import sys sys.setdefaulte...

如何解决 golang 中的 “undefined: database/sql.Open” 错误

来越多的开发者的喜爱。其中 database/sql 是 Go 中一个重要的包,它提供了开发者与数据库交互的接口。然而,在使用 database/sql.Open 的过程中,开发者可能会遇到一个经典的错误:“undefined: database/sql.Open”。本文将详细介绍产生该错误的原因,并提供几种解决方法。错误原因在 Go 语言中,大写字母开头的符号表示该符号是公有的,可以在其他包中被调用...

如何解决 golang 中的 "unexpected newline, expecting comma or }” 错误

在使用 Golang 进行编程的过程中,经常会遇到 "unexpected newline, expecting comma or }” 的错误提示。这种错误提示不仅会让程序出现异常,还会占用我们宝贵的时间和精力。本文将介绍如何解决这种错误,让您的 Golang 编程更加轻松愉快。首先,我们需要知道这种错误是由什么原因引起的。这种错误通常是由于代码中花括号匹配不正确所引起的。Golang 语言是一种...
© 2024 LMLPHP 关于我们 联系我们 友情链接 耗时0.012465(s)
2024-05-20 05:40:43 1716154843